Argo Pilot Service Launches November 26

Effective November 26, Argo’s fully electric Smart Routing™ on-demand pilot service will be available in the downtown Brampton area making it easier than ever to take Brampton Transit and GO Transit with PRESTO.
 
Residents can download the Argo app to register. The app is available on the iOS Apple Store and Google Play Store 
 
No smartphone? You could also request a ride by calling 888-401-8252. ​

CLOSURE ALERT: Downtown Terminal Customer Service Counters Temporarily CLOSED

Effective Tuesday, October 14, 2025, until further notice, the Downtown Terminal Customer Service Counters will be temporarily closed. The terminal building will remain open to provide access to the washrooms. Bus services will continue to operate as scheduled.

To load your PRESTO card, visit prestocard.ca​ or visit the Bramalea or Brampton Gateway Terminals.

For route and schedule information, call our Contact Centre at 905.874.2999 or visit bramptontransit.com​.

Temporary stop changes due to underground parking construction at 8 Nelson Street West

Effective Wednesday, August 13, 2025 until further notice, due to critical repairs at the 8 Nelson Parking Garage, the Downtown Transit Terminal South Pla​tform will be closed during Phase 1 of construction. The following Brampton Transit route stops will be relocated to temporary on-street bus stops for: ​

1. Route 501 Züm Queen Eastbound - Temporary Stop on George Street, south of Nelson Street 
2. Route 1/1A Queen Eastbound - Temporary Stop on George Street, north of Nelson Street

During this time, the north platform will remain open for buses and riders. Signage will be posted to help riders navigate temporary stop locations.

As this work is being completed in a phased approach, additional closures may occur.​
